Cork GAA will host its Annual Strength & Conditioning Conference for Club Coaches on Saturday, 29th November, from 9:30 AM to 12:30 PM at SuperValu Páirc Uí Chaoimh.
This event offers a valuable opportunity to explore best practices in Strength & Conditioning across clubs, schools, and intercounty teams. With a focus on youth and adult development for both male and female athletes, speakers will share insights drawn from Gaelic games, soccer, and rugby.
Conference Theme
"Building & Rebuilding Robust, Athletic Teams and Athletes: Insights from Gaelic Games, Soccer, and Rugby"
Keynote Speakers & Panel Discussion
Paudie Roche
Physical Performance Specialist; Former Lead S&C Coach, Arsenal Women and Academy
Topic: Building Durable Female and Academy Athletes – S&C Strategies from Arsenal FC
Gordon Brett
Rehabilitation Coach; Former S&C/Rehab Coach with Leinster, Munster, and Wasps Rugby
Topic: Rebuilding the High-Performance Athlete – Rehab Strategies from Elite Rugby
Cathal O’Brien
S&C Coach; Cork Senior Hurlers and Ballinhassig Senior Hurlers
Topic: Bulletproofing the Club Hurler – S&C Strategies from Club and Intercounty Hurling
Aidan O’Connell
High Performance Manager, Cork GAA; S&C Coach, Carrigaline Senior Footballers
Topic: Optimising Athlete Availability – S&C Strategies from Club and Intercounty Football
